WebBest Case Time Complexity The same situation occurs in best case since again the array is unsorted: V calculations O (V) time Total: O (V^2) Case 2: Binary Heap + Priority Queue To improve our intial implementation of the algorithm, we can switch to using a priority queue and a binary heap instead of the unsorted array. Web5 de abr. de 2024 ·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the minimum …
On the Best Case of Heapsort - ScienceDirect
Web19 de ago. de 2024 · Heapsort is an efficient, unstable sorting algorithm with an average, best-case, and worst-case time complexity of O(n log n). Heapsort is significantly slower … WebHeapsort can be thought of as an improved selection sort: like selection sort, heapsort divides its input into a sorted and an unsorted region, and it iteratively shrinks the unsorted region by extracting the largest element from it and inserting it into the sorted region. residential door security hardware
IT3CO06 Design and Analysis of Algorithm PDF - Scribd
WebWrite the asymptotic notations used for best case, ... Also discuss the complexity of the heap sort. ... What is the best time complexity of bubble sort? 1 (c) N Q.4 i. General principle of greedy algorithm. 3 iii ... Webcase running time is O(nlogn). Moreover, this expected case running time occurs with high proba-bility, in that the probability that the algorithm takes significantly more than O(nlogn)time is rapidly decreasing function of n. In addition, QuickSort has a better locality-of-reference behavior than either MergeSort or HeapSort, and thus it ... Web1 de mar. de 1996 · Here we investigate thebest caseof Heapsort. Contrary to claims made by some authors that its time complexity isO(n), i.e., linear in the number of items, we prove that it is actuallyO(nlogn) and is, in fact, approximately half that of the worst case. Our proof contains a construction for an asymptotically best-case heap. protein and nutrition shakes